          I peeled off the subpop sticker on the front of the sleeve and found a sticker below. It read "Fatbeats exclusive. Limited edition of 500 on swerve red vinyl"

          Not sure if that 500 count is accurate but I'd be surprised if it wasn't.

          Pressing is great though. As reported by other listeners though, the packaging is the same as the original 2011 release.
